
FX取引で安定した収益を上げるために欠かせないのが過去検証です。しかし、「検証の必要性は分かるけどやり方が分からない」「どこから始めれば良いのか悩んでいる」という声をよく耳にします。この記事では、15年のトレード経験から得た具体的な検証方法と、初心者でも実践できるステップを詳しく解説します。
FX過去検証が必要な理由

過去検証をせずにトレードを始めると、必要以上の損失を被るリスクが高まります。実際に、私の経験からも検証なしでのトレードは、感情的な判断や場当たり的な取引につながりやすいことが分かっています。
検証がないと起こる3つの失敗パターン
過去検証を行わないトレードには、以下のような典型的な失敗パターンが存在します。
- 感情的なトレード:損失を取り戻そうとして、さらなる損失を重ねてしまう
- 根拠のない取引:明確なルールがないため、場当たり的な判断で取引してしまう
- リスク管理の欠如:適切な損切り位置が分からず、大きな損失を抱えてしまう
検証で得られる3つのメリット
一方で、適切な過去検証を行うことで、以下のような具体的なメリットが得られます。
| メリット | 具体的な効果 |
|---|---|
| トレードの客観化 | 感情に左右されない明確な取引ルールの確立 |
| リスク管理の向上 | 適切な損切り位置の把握と資金管理の最適化 |
| 手法の検証 | 勝率とリスクリワード比の定量的な把握 |
過去検証の具体的な手順

過去検証を効果的に行うには、体系的なアプローチが重要です。ここでは、初心者でも実践できる具体的な手順を、実例を交えながら解説していきます。
STEP1:検証テーマの設定
検証を始める前に、明確なテーマを設定する必要があります。漠然と「儲かる手法を見つけたい」という目標では、具体的な検証ができません。以下のような具体的なテーマ設定を心がけましょう。
- 移動平均線のゴールデンクロスは本当に有効なのか
- ダブルトップ・ボトムの形成後、どの程度の値動きが期待できるか
- ロンドン市場の寄付き後30分の値動きに特徴はあるか
STEP2:データ収集方法の選択

検証に必要なデータを収集する方法は、主に以下の3つがあります。自分の目的と環境に合った方法を選択しましょう。
| 収集方法 | 特徴 | 向いている人 |
|---|---|---|
| MT4/MT5でのマニュアル検証 | コストがかからず、すぐに始められる | 初心者、予算を抑えたい人 |
| 専用検証ソフト | 効率的なデータ収集が可能 | 本格的に取り組みたい人 |
| エクセルでの記録 | 細かいデータ分析が可能 | データ分析重視の人 |
STEP3:検証の実施とデータ記録
検証を行う際は、以下の項目を必ず記録するようにしましょう。記録が不十分だと、後から分析する際に重要な情報が欠落している可能性があります。
- 基本情報:日時、通貨ペア、時間足
- エントリー情報:エントリー価格、損切り位置、利確目標
- 結果データ:獲得pips、保有時間、勝敗
- 市場環境:トレンドの方向、重要指標の有無
STEP4:結果分析と改善点の抽出
最低100回以上のトレードデータを収集したら、以下の観点で分析を行います。この分析結果が、手法の改善につながる重要な指標となります。
- 全体の勝率(55%以上が目安)
- 平均利益/平均損失の比率(1.5以上が望ましい)
- 最大ドローダウン(証拠金の20%以内に抑えたい)
- 連敗回数(資金管理の計画に重要)
効果的な検証のためのツール選び

検証効率を上げるためには、適切なツールの選択が重要です。予算や目的に応じて、最適なツールを選びましょう。
MT4/MT5による検証の方法
MT4/MT5は無料で使える基本的な検証ツールです。特にストラテジーテスター機能を活用することで、効率的な検証が可能になります。
ストラテジーテスターの基本設定
以下の手順で設定を行います:
- 「表示」メニューから「ストラテジーテスター」を選択
- 通貨ペアと期間を設定
- テスト期間の指定(最低5年以上推奨)
- スプレッドの設定(実際の取引環境に近い値に)
専用検証ソフトの活用法
![]()
参照:Forex Tester
より本格的な検証を行うなら、Forex Testerなどの専用ソフトの使用を推奨します。以下のような機能が作業効率を大きく向上させます:
- 高速な巻き戻し・早送り機能
- 詳細な統計データの自動集計
- 複数の時間足の同時表示
- チャート上への記録機能
エクセルによるデータ管理
![]()
参照:GogoJungle
検証データの記録・分析には、エクセルの活用が効果的です。以下のような項目を記録することで、詳細な分析が可能になります。
| 記録項目 | 記録内容 | 分析目的 |
|---|---|---|
| 日時データ | エントリー/決済時刻 | 時間帯別の成績分析 |
| 価格データ | エントリー/決済価格 | 収益性の分析 |
| 環境データ | 市場状況/指標発表 | 相場環境との相関分析 |
実践トレードへの移行方法

検証で良好な結果が得られたら、実践トレードへの移行を検討します。ただし、いきなり実口座での取引を始めるのではなく、段階的なアプローチを取ることが重要です。
デモトレードでの確認
まずはデモ口座で、検証結果の再現性を確認します。この段階で以下のポイントを重点的にチェックしましょう:
- 検証時の勝率が実際に出せるか
- スプレッドの影響はどの程度か
- 約定時のスリッページはないか
- 感情的な判断が入り込まないか
少額取引からの開始
デモトレードで問題がなければ、最小ロットでの実取引を開始します。この際、以下の原則を守ることが重要です:
資金管理の原則
- 1回の取引リスクは口座資金の1%以下
- 同時エントリーは2ポジションまで
- 週単位での損失上限を設定
スケールアップの判断基準
取引サイズを増やす際は、以下の条件が揃っているか確認します:
- 3ヶ月以上連続で利益を確保
- 最大ドローダウンが想定内
- 感情的な判断が排除できている
- リスク管理が適切に機能している
よくある失敗と対処法

過去検証では、いくつかの典型的な失敗パターンが存在します。これらを事前に理解し、適切に対処することで、より効果的な検証が可能になります。
データ不足の問題
多くのトレーダーが陥りやすい失敗が、検証データの不足です。私の経験では、以下の基準を満たすことで、より信頼性の高い検証が可能になります:
- 検証期間:最低5年以上
- トレード回数:300回以上
- 市場環境:複数の相場環境を含む
過剰最適化の罠
検証結果を良くしようとするあまり、パラメーターを過度に調整してしまうケースがあります。これを避けるために、以下のポイントに注意しましょう:
- 一度に変更するパラメーターは1つまで
- 検証期間を分割して、別期間での有効性も確認
- 極端に高い勝率を求めすぎない
- 現実的なリスクリワード比を維持する
感情的な判断の排除
検証中も感情が入り込む可能性があります。特に以下のような場面では注意が必要です:
| 状況 | 問題点 | 対処法 |
|---|---|---|
| 連敗時 | ルールの変更を検討 | 事前に定めた基準を厳守 |
| 大きな利益時 | 過度な期待を持つ | 統計的な視点を維持 |
| ドローダウン時 | 検証を中断したくなる | 長期的な視点を持つ |
まとめ:効果的な過去検証のポイント

これまでの内容を踏まえ、効果的な過去検証を行うための重要ポイントをまとめます:
- 十分なデータ量の確保:最低300回以上のトレード検証
- システマティックな記録:感情に左右されない客観的な記録
- 段階的なアプローチ:デモ取引から実取引へ慎重に移行
- 継続的な改善:定期的な検証と手法の見直し
過去検証は、FXトレードにおける「投資」だと考えてください。時間と労力はかかりますが、その見返りとして得られる知見と自信は、将来のトレードで何倍にもなって返ってきます。焦らず着実に、自分に合った検証スタイルを確立していくことをお勧めします。
※関連記事